Microsoft.Network virtualNetworks/virtualNetworkPeerings 2023-05-01

Bicep kaynak tanımı

virtualNetworks/virtualNetworkPeerings kaynak türü, aşağıdakileri hedefleyen işlemlerle dağıtılabilir:

  • kaynak grupları - Bkz. kaynak grubu dağıtım komutları

Her API sürümünde değiştirilen özelliklerin listesi için bkz. değişiklik günlüğü.

Kaynak biçimi

Microsoft.Network/virtualNetworks/virtualNetworkPeerings kaynağı oluşturmak için şablonunuza aşağıdaki Bicep'i ekleyin.

resource symbolicname 'Microsoft.Network/virtualNetworks/virtualNetworkPeerings@2023-05-01' = {
  name: 'string'
  properties: {
    allowForwardedTraffic: bool
    allowGatewayTransit: bool
    allowVirtualNetworkAccess: bool
    doNotVerifyRemoteGateways: bool
    peeringState: 'string'
    peeringSyncLevel: 'string'
    remoteAddressSpace: {
      addressPrefixes: [
        'string'
      ]
    }
    remoteBgpCommunities: {
      virtualNetworkCommunity: 'string'
    }
    remoteVirtualNetwork: {
      id: 'string'
    }
    remoteVirtualNetworkAddressSpace: {
      addressPrefixes: [
        'string'
      ]
    }
    useRemoteGateways: bool
  }
}

Özellik değerleri

AddressSpace

Ad Açıklama Değer
addressPrefixes CIDR gösteriminde bu sanal ağ için ayrılmış adres bloklarının listesi. string[]

Microsoft.Network/virtualNetworks/virtualNetworkPeerings

Ad Açıklama Değer
ad Kaynak adı dize (gerekli)
ebeveyn Bicep'te bir alt kaynak için üst kaynak belirtebilirsiniz. Bu özelliği yalnızca alt kaynak üst kaynağın dışında bildirildiğinde eklemeniz gerekir.

Daha fazla bilgi için bkz. Alt kaynaküst kaynak dışında.
Kaynak türü için sembolik ad: virtualNetworks
Özellikler Sanal ağ eşlemesinin özellikleri. VirtualNetworkPeeringPropertiesFormat

Alt Kaynak

Ad Açıklama Değer
Kimliği Kaynak Kimliği. dizgi

VirtualNetworkBgpCommunities

Ad Açıklama Değer
virtualNetworkCommunity Sanal ağ ile ilişkili BGP topluluğu. dize (gerekli)

VirtualNetworkPeeringPropertiesFormat

Ad Açıklama Değer
allowForwardedTraffic Yerel sanal ağdaki VM'lerden iletilen trafiğe uzak sanal ağda izin verilip verilmeyeceği. Bool
allowGatewayTransit Ağ geçidi bağlantıları, bu sanal ağa bağlanmak için uzak sanal ağda kullanılabiliyorsa. Bool
allowVirtualNetworkAccess Yerel sanal ağ alanında bulunan VM'lerin uzak sanal ağ alanında bulunan VM'lere erişip erişemeyeceği. Bool
doNotVerifyRemoteGateways Uzak ağ geçidinin sağlama durumunu doğrulamamız gerekiyorsa. Bool
peeringState Sanal ağ eşlemesinin durumu. 'Bağlı'
'Bağlantısı Kesildi'
'Başlatıldı'
peeringSyncLevel Sanal ağ eşlemesinin eşleme eşitleme durumu. 'FullyInSync'
'LocalAndRemoteNotInSync'
'LocalNotInSync'
'RemoteNotInSync'
remoteAddressSpace Uzak sanal ağ ile eşlenen adres alanına başvuru. AddressSpace
remoteBgpCommunities Uzak sanal ağın Bgp Topluluklarına başvuru. VirtualNetworkBgpCommunities
remoteVirtualNetwork Uzak sanal ağa başvuru. Uzak sanal ağ aynı veya farklı bölgede (önizleme) olabilir. Önizlemeye kaydolmak ve daha fazla bilgi edinmek için buraya bakın (/azure/virtual-network/virtual-network-create-peering). AltKaynak
remoteVirtualNetworkAddressSpace Uzak sanal ağın geçerli adres alanına başvuru. AddressSpace
useRemoteGateways Bu sanal ağda uzak ağ geçitleri kullanılabiliyorsa. Bayrağı true olarak ayarlanırsa ve uzak eşlemede allowGatewayTransit de doğruysa, sanal ağ aktarım için uzak sanal ağ ağ geçitlerini kullanır. Yalnızca bir eşlemede bu bayrak true olarak ayarlanabilir. Sanal ağın zaten bir ağ geçidi varsa bu bayrak ayarlanamaz. Bool

Hızlı başlangıç örnekleri

Aşağıdaki hızlı başlangıç örnekleri bu kaynak türünü dağıtır.

Bicep Dosyası Açıklama
Azure Oyun Geliştirici Sanal Makinesi Azure Oyun Geliştirici Sanal Makinesi, Unreal gibi Licencsed Altyapıları içerir.
Sanal Ağ Eşleme kullanarak sanal ağdan sanal ağa bağlantı oluşturma Bu şablon, sanal ağ eşlemesini kullanarak iki sanal ağa bağlanmanızı sağlar
Merkez Sanal Ağ bastion konağı dağıtma Bu şablon eşlemeleri olan iki sanal ağ, Hub sanal akında bir Bastion konağı ve uç sanal akında bir Linux VM oluşturur
Var olan iki sanal ağı tek bir bölge içinde eşleme Bu şablon, VNet Eşlemesi'ni kullanarak aynı bölgedeki aynı veya farklı kaynak gruplarından iki VNET bağlamanızı sağlar
Ağ Geçidi Yük Dengeleyici zincirlenmiş Genel Yük Dengeleyici Bu şablon, Ağ Geçidi Load Balancer'a zincirlenmiş bir Genel Standart Yük Dengeleyici dağıtmanızı sağlar. İnternet'ten gelen trafik, arka uç havuzunda linux VM'leri (NVA) bulunan Ağ Geçidi Load Balancer'a yönlendirilir.
Azure Güvenlik Duvarı'nı Merkez & Uç topolojisinde DNS Proxy'si olarak kullanma Bu örnek, Azure Güvenlik Duvarı'nı kullanarak Azure'da merkez-uç topolojisinin nasıl dağıtılacağı gösterilmektedir. Merkez sanal ağı, sanal ağ eşlemesi aracılığıyla merkez sanal ağına bağlanan birçok uç sanal ağına merkezi bir bağlantı noktası işlevi görür.

ARM şablonu kaynak tanımı

virtualNetworks/virtualNetworkPeerings kaynak türü, aşağıdakileri hedefleyen işlemlerle dağıtılabilir:

  • kaynak grupları - Bkz. kaynak grubu dağıtım komutları

Her API sürümünde değiştirilen özelliklerin listesi için bkz. değişiklik günlüğü.

Kaynak biçimi

Microsoft.Network/virtualNetworks/virtualNetworkPeerings kaynağı oluşturmak için şablonunuza aşağıdaki JSON'u ekleyin.

{
  "type": "Microsoft.Network/virtualNetworks/virtualNetworkPeerings",
  "apiVersion": "2023-05-01",
  "name": "string",
  "properties": {
    "allowForwardedTraffic": "bool",
    "allowGatewayTransit": "bool",
    "allowVirtualNetworkAccess": "bool",
    "doNotVerifyRemoteGateways": "bool",
    "peeringState": "string",
    "peeringSyncLevel": "string",
    "remoteAddressSpace": {
      "addressPrefixes": [ "string" ]
    },
    "remoteBgpCommunities": {
      "virtualNetworkCommunity": "string"
    },
    "remoteVirtualNetwork": {
      "id": "string"
    },
    "remoteVirtualNetworkAddressSpace": {
      "addressPrefixes": [ "string" ]
    },
    "useRemoteGateways": "bool"
  }
}

Özellik değerleri

AddressSpace

Ad Açıklama Değer
addressPrefixes CIDR gösteriminde bu sanal ağ için ayrılmış adres bloklarının listesi. string[]

Microsoft.Network/virtualNetworks/virtualNetworkPeerings

Ad Açıklama Değer
apiVersion API sürümü '2023-05-01'
ad Kaynak adı dize (gerekli)
Özellikler Sanal ağ eşlemesinin özellikleri. VirtualNetworkPeeringPropertiesFormat
tür Kaynak türü 'Microsoft.Network/virtualNetworks/virtualNetworkPeerings'

Alt Kaynak

Ad Açıklama Değer
Kimliği Kaynak Kimliği. dizgi

VirtualNetworkBgpCommunities

Ad Açıklama Değer
virtualNetworkCommunity Sanal ağ ile ilişkili BGP topluluğu. dize (gerekli)

VirtualNetworkPeeringPropertiesFormat

Ad Açıklama Değer
allowForwardedTraffic Yerel sanal ağdaki VM'lerden iletilen trafiğe uzak sanal ağda izin verilip verilmeyeceği. Bool
allowGatewayTransit Ağ geçidi bağlantıları, bu sanal ağa bağlanmak için uzak sanal ağda kullanılabiliyorsa. Bool
allowVirtualNetworkAccess Yerel sanal ağ alanında bulunan VM'lerin uzak sanal ağ alanında bulunan VM'lere erişip erişemeyeceği. Bool
doNotVerifyRemoteGateways Uzak ağ geçidinin sağlama durumunu doğrulamamız gerekiyorsa. Bool
peeringState Sanal ağ eşlemesinin durumu. 'Bağlı'
'Bağlantısı Kesildi'
'Başlatıldı'
peeringSyncLevel Sanal ağ eşlemesinin eşleme eşitleme durumu. 'FullyInSync'
'LocalAndRemoteNotInSync'
'LocalNotInSync'
'RemoteNotInSync'
remoteAddressSpace Uzak sanal ağ ile eşlenen adres alanına başvuru. AddressSpace
remoteBgpCommunities Uzak sanal ağın Bgp Topluluklarına başvuru. VirtualNetworkBgpCommunities
remoteVirtualNetwork Uzak sanal ağa başvuru. Uzak sanal ağ aynı veya farklı bölgede (önizleme) olabilir. Önizlemeye kaydolmak ve daha fazla bilgi edinmek için buraya bakın (/azure/virtual-network/virtual-network-create-peering). AltKaynak
remoteVirtualNetworkAddressSpace Uzak sanal ağın geçerli adres alanına başvuru. AddressSpace
useRemoteGateways Bu sanal ağda uzak ağ geçitleri kullanılabiliyorsa. Bayrağı true olarak ayarlanırsa ve uzak eşlemede allowGatewayTransit de doğruysa, sanal ağ aktarım için uzak sanal ağ ağ geçitlerini kullanır. Yalnızca bir eşlemede bu bayrak true olarak ayarlanabilir. Sanal ağın zaten bir ağ geçidi varsa bu bayrak ayarlanamaz. Bool

Hızlı başlangıç şablonları

Aşağıdaki hızlı başlangıç şablonları bu kaynak türünü dağıtır.

Şablon Açıklama
Azure Oyun Geliştirici Sanal Makinesi

Azure 'a dağıtma
Azure Oyun Geliştirici Sanal Makinesi, Unreal gibi Licencsed Altyapıları içerir.
Sanal Ağ Eşleme kullanarak sanal ağdan sanal ağa bağlantı oluşturma

Azure 'a dağıtma
Bu şablon, sanal ağ eşlemesini kullanarak iki sanal ağa bağlanmanızı sağlar
Zorlamalı tünel ile Azure Güvenlik Duvarı korumalı alanı oluşturma

Azure 'a dağıtma
Bu şablon, eşlenmiş bir sanal ağda başka bir güvenlik duvarından tünelle bir güvenlik duvarı zorlamasıyla bir Azure Güvenlik Duvarı korumalı alanı (Linux) oluşturur
Merkez Sanal Ağ bastion konağı dağıtma

Azure 'a dağıtma
Bu şablon eşlemeleri olan iki sanal ağ, Hub sanal akında bir Bastion konağı ve uç sanal akında bir Linux VM oluşturur
Merkez-Uç topolojisi korumalı alanı dağıtma

Azure 'a dağıtma
Bu şablon temel bir merkez-uç topolojisi kurulumu oluşturur. DMZ, Yönetim, Paylaşılan ve Ağ Geçidi alt ağlarına (isteğe bağlı olarak) sahip ve her birinde bir iş yükü alt ağı içeren iki Uç sanal ağı (geliştirme ve üretim) olan bir Hub sanal ağı oluşturur. Ayrıca HUB'ın Yönetim alt aya bir Windows Jump-Host dağıtır ve Hub ile iki uç arasında sanal ağ eşlemeleri oluşturur.
Bir bölgede iki sanal ağ ile HBase çoğaltması dağıtma

Azure 'a dağıtma
Bu şablon, HBase çoğaltmasını yapılandırmak için aynı bölgedeki iki sanal ağ içinde iki HBase kümesiyle aN HBase ortamı yapılandırmanıza olanak tanır.
Var olan iki sanal ağı tek bir bölge içinde eşleme

Azure 'a dağıtma
Bu şablon, VNet Eşlemesi'ni kullanarak aynı bölgedeki aynı veya farklı kaynak gruplarından iki VNET bağlamanızı sağlar
Ağ Geçidi Yük Dengeleyici zincirlenmiş Genel Yük Dengeleyici

Azure 'a dağıtma
Bu şablon, Ağ Geçidi Load Balancer'a zincirlenmiş bir Genel Standart Yük Dengeleyici dağıtmanızı sağlar. İnternet'ten gelen trafik, arka uç havuzunda linux VM'leri (NVA) bulunan Ağ Geçidi Load Balancer'a yönlendirilir.
Azure Güvenlik Duvarı'nı Merkez & Uç topolojisinde DNS Proxy'si olarak kullanma

Azure 'a dağıtma
Bu örnek, Azure Güvenlik Duvarı'nı kullanarak Azure'da merkez-uç topolojisinin nasıl dağıtılacağı gösterilmektedir. Merkez sanal ağı, sanal ağ eşlemesi aracılığıyla merkez sanal ağına bağlanan birçok uç sanal ağına merkezi bir bağlantı noktası işlevi görür.

Terraform (AzAPI sağlayıcısı) kaynak tanımı

virtualNetworks/virtualNetworkPeerings kaynak türü, aşağıdakileri hedefleyen işlemlerle dağıtılabilir:

  • Kaynak grupları

Her API sürümünde değiştirilen özelliklerin listesi için bkz. değişiklik günlüğü.

Kaynak biçimi

Microsoft.Network/virtualNetworks/virtualNetworkPeerings kaynağı oluşturmak için şablonunuza aşağıdaki Terraform'u ekleyin.

resource "azapi_resource" "symbolicname" {
  type = "Microsoft.Network/virtualNetworks/virtualNetworkPeerings@2023-05-01"
  name = "string"
  body = jsonencode({
    properties = {
      allowForwardedTraffic = bool
      allowGatewayTransit = bool
      allowVirtualNetworkAccess = bool
      doNotVerifyRemoteGateways = bool
      peeringState = "string"
      peeringSyncLevel = "string"
      remoteAddressSpace = {
        addressPrefixes = [
          "string"
        ]
      }
      remoteBgpCommunities = {
        virtualNetworkCommunity = "string"
      }
      remoteVirtualNetwork = {
        id = "string"
      }
      remoteVirtualNetworkAddressSpace = {
        addressPrefixes = [
          "string"
        ]
      }
      useRemoteGateways = bool
    }
  })
}

Özellik değerleri

AddressSpace

Ad Açıklama Değer
addressPrefixes CIDR gösteriminde bu sanal ağ için ayrılmış adres bloklarının listesi. string[]

Microsoft.Network/virtualNetworks/virtualNetworkPeerings

Ad Açıklama Değer
ad Kaynak adı dize (gerekli)
parent_id Bu kaynağın üst öğesi olan kaynağın kimliği. Tür kaynağı kimliği: virtualNetworks
Özellikler Sanal ağ eşlemesinin özellikleri. VirtualNetworkPeeringPropertiesFormat
tür Kaynak türü "Microsoft.Network/virtualNetworks/virtualNetworkPeerings@2023-05-01"

Alt Kaynak

Ad Açıklama Değer
Kimliği Kaynak Kimliği. dizgi

VirtualNetworkBgpCommunities

Ad Açıklama Değer
virtualNetworkCommunity Sanal ağ ile ilişkili BGP topluluğu. dize (gerekli)

VirtualNetworkPeeringPropertiesFormat

Ad Açıklama Değer
allowForwardedTraffic Yerel sanal ağdaki VM'lerden iletilen trafiğe uzak sanal ağda izin verilip verilmeyeceği. Bool
allowGatewayTransit Ağ geçidi bağlantıları, bu sanal ağa bağlanmak için uzak sanal ağda kullanılabiliyorsa. Bool
allowVirtualNetworkAccess Yerel sanal ağ alanında bulunan VM'lerin uzak sanal ağ alanında bulunan VM'lere erişip erişemeyeceği. Bool
doNotVerifyRemoteGateways Uzak ağ geçidinin sağlama durumunu doğrulamamız gerekiyorsa. Bool
peeringState Sanal ağ eşlemesinin durumu. 'Bağlı'
'Bağlantısı Kesildi'
'Başlatıldı'
peeringSyncLevel Sanal ağ eşlemesinin eşleme eşitleme durumu. 'FullyInSync'
'LocalAndRemoteNotInSync'
'LocalNotInSync'
'RemoteNotInSync'
remoteAddressSpace Uzak sanal ağ ile eşlenen adres alanına başvuru. AddressSpace
remoteBgpCommunities Uzak sanal ağın Bgp Topluluklarına başvuru. VirtualNetworkBgpCommunities
remoteVirtualNetwork Uzak sanal ağa başvuru. Uzak sanal ağ aynı veya farklı bölgede (önizleme) olabilir. Önizlemeye kaydolmak ve daha fazla bilgi edinmek için buraya bakın (/azure/virtual-network/virtual-network-create-peering). AltKaynak
remoteVirtualNetworkAddressSpace Uzak sanal ağın geçerli adres alanına başvuru. AddressSpace
useRemoteGateways Bu sanal ağda uzak ağ geçitleri kullanılabiliyorsa. Bayrağı true olarak ayarlanırsa ve uzak eşlemede allowGatewayTransit de doğruysa, sanal ağ aktarım için uzak sanal ağ ağ geçitlerini kullanır. Yalnızca bir eşlemede bu bayrak true olarak ayarlanabilir. Sanal ağın zaten bir ağ geçidi varsa bu bayrak ayarlanamaz. Bool